An Automatic Clamp is held in clamping position by mechanical means when the clamping power source fails. The prevention of an alternate source of power avoids the continued machining of a part that is no longer clamped and the resultant damage. Strong springs, toggle linkages, cone locks, wrench-pressured oil, prestressed diaphragm clamps, small angle wedge cams, or spring-loaded collets or chucks are the mechanical means of holding automatic clamps. Frequently stops are added to prevent damage to the fixture in the event no parts is place during the clamping operation.
